So, Vampire Academy By Richelle Mead.

Before we start this review, I have to confess something.
I tried to read this first book last summer. However, I found it difficult to lose myself in the world and connect to the characters. I didn't like the fact that you only get to know what a "dhampire" is after fifty pages. So I stopped reading it and moved on to something else.

But, my friend read the series and loved it so much so I decided to give it another shot. I read the first book and I enjoyed it a lot.

The story follows two best friends: Lissa, who is a mortal vampire (aka Moroi), and Rose, Lissa's best friend and her half-vampire bodyguard. She's is trying to protect her from the immortal vampires, the dark evil ones called "Strigoi", after escaping their academy (which is a high school for morois and dhampires). They also happen to share a bond that allows Rose to read Lissa's emotions.

The story is told from Rose's perspective which I loved. Rose is loud, reckless, sarcastic, strong, kick-butt... which is why I love her.
As the story goes on, the mystery behind Rose and Lissa's escape unfolds and we start to see more of Lissa's character.

All in all, the book was a bit confusing at first, but then it was funny, action-packed, romantic at bits... It was a fun read. I loved it and I can't wait to read the second book.

Out of five stars, I gave it four and a half.
